LZ Granderson: In Brown v. Board of Education, the decision was a matter of principle. He says it's been useful for white people to explain black problems as result of something personal internal. LZ: The court instead made the case that black people are psychologically crippled by their inferior schooling. "You cannot lock black people out of the place where social power and opportunity reside"
